World Vision
Wondering what to get your grandparents, best friend, cousin, brother-in-law this Christmas? World Vision Alternative Gifts has its best range ever to help you find that perfect gift this Christmas. Favourite gifts such as fruit trees (£10), goats (£17) and child vaccinations(£20) have been combined with unique new gifts like a cowpat stove (£34) and a llama (£45)
World Vision Alternative Gifts has 79 gifts to choose from, which will directly benefit 34 of World Vision’s community projects across 16 developing countries in Africa, Asia, Eastern Europe and South America. There are also a range of emergency gifts that allow World Vision to respond quickly in emergency situations caused by natural disasters or conflicts. With all gifts having been specifically requested as part of projects by the communities, you can be sure your gift really will make a real difference to the lives of others this Christmas time.

Action Aid Gifts in Action
ActionAid’s interactive Gifts in Action offer you the chance to buy unusual and thoughtful gifts – whilst also helping poor communities gain the skills and knowledge to transform their lives.
They’ve got a huge range of gifts, and with Gifts in Action, everyone on your shopping list will get something special to open. That’s because each gift comes with an interactive card, illustrating the type of work your donation might help to make possible somewhere in the world.
What’s more, you could even choose to give your family or friends an interactive e-card – perfect for those last minute presents.
Available gifts include books for schoolchildren, chickens for breeding and training for a midwife.
